> @@ -127,4 +135,25 @@  
> Puppet::Type.type(:package).provide :dpkg, :parent =>  
> Puppet::Provider::Package
>     def purge
>         dpkg "--purge", @resource[:name]
>     end
> +
> +    def hold
> +        self.install
> +        begin
> +            Tempfile.open('puppet_dpkg_set_selection') { |tmpfile|
> +                tmpfile.write("#...@resource[:name]} hold\n")
> +                tmpfile.flush
> +                execute([:dpkg, "--set-selections"], :stdinfile =>  
> tmpfile.path.to_s)

That's really necessary? Ouch.

> +            }
> +        end
> +    end
> +
> +    def unhold
> +        begin
> +            Tempfile.open('puppet_dpkg_set_selection') { |tmpfile|
> +                tmpfile.write("#...@resource[:name]} install\n")
> +                tmpfile.flush
> +                execute([:dpkg, "--set-selections"], :stdinfile =>  
> tmpfile.path.to_s)
> +            }
> +        end
> +    end
> end
> diff --git a/lib/puppet/type/package.rb b/lib/puppet/type/package.rb
> index bb3db28..789d27f 100644
> --- a/lib/puppet/type/package.rb
> +++ b/lib/puppet/type/package.rb
> @@ -31,6 +31,10 @@ module Puppet
>                 existing configuration files.  This feature is thus  
> destructive
>                 and should be used with the utmost care.",
>             :methods => [:purge]
> +        feature :holdable, "The provider can hold packages. This  
> generally means
> +                that the package will not be automatically  
> upgraded. Note that
> +                a held status is considered a superset of installed",
> +            :methods => [:hold]
>         feature :versionable, "The provider is capable of  
> interrogating the
>                 package database for installed version(s), and can  
> select
>                 which out of a set of available versions of a  
> package to
> @@ -60,6 +64,10 @@ module Puppet
>                 provider.purge
>             end
>
> +            newvalue(:held, :event  
> => :package_held, :required_features => :holdable) do
> +                provider.hold
> +            end
> +
>             # Alias the 'present' value.
>             aliasvalue(:installed, :present)
>
> @@ -111,7 +119,7 @@ module Puppet
>                 @should.each { |should|
>                     case should
>                     when :present
> -                        return true unless  
> [:absent, :purged].include?(is)
> +                        return true unless  
> [:absent, :purged, :held].include?(is)
>                     when :latest
>                         # Short-circuit packages that are not present
>                         return false if is == :absent or is == :purged
